Cell phone holder, built into your
2021 F-150..
Seems the best cell phone holder I've ever used is right there in your cab..
Doesn't matter what trim package you have..
As you see by the pic I've posted, you simply pull back the lid on the forward compartment..
There are 2 lips inside, set your phone on the first lip, tip the phone back and let it rest against the dash, between the volume and tuning knob on your radio.
Let the compartments spring loaded lid go against the phone..
It will hold it very tightly.
Depending on phone which inside lip you rest your phone on, should work for most any phone..
This is a Samsung 10+ in a simple rubber case resting on the 1st lip inside compartment.
Give it a try..
I love it, works great for me..
